An approach to a reference model for a sentient smart city

Abstract

The interest about Smart City concept has in creased in recent years. In fact, Smart Cities is ex pected to improve cityzens life experience by driv ing the next digital revolution, moving from the personal area (mobile computing, smart home) to the urban area (collective computing and collective intelligence). But the development of Smart Cities is not being as fast as expected. Several problems need to be undertaken in order to achieve the ob jectives of the paradigm. This paper presents an approach to address one of these problems: to or chestrate the platform that is required for gathering information about city, store it in a model and ena ble it for exploitation. The heterogeneity of the po tential data sources available and the complexity of the information nature and structure, make it a non trivial task that have to be solved before commer cial solutions appear and provide specific and non interoperable solutions.
